matlab筆記二(陣列的建立)

2022-06-28 07:21:11 字數 607 閱讀 8428

1、x=[3 9] 行向量

x=[3;9]   列向量

2、x^2   表示x的二次方

4、建立等間距向量

(1)x=1:4  相當於建立:   x=[1 2 3 4 ]

(2) 運算子使用預設的間距1,但是您可以指定您自己的間距,如下所示。

x=20:2:26

x=20222426

(3)如果您知道向量中所需的元素數目(而不是每個元素之間的間距),則可以改用linspace函式:

linspace(first,last,number_of_elements)

開始,結尾數字,元素個數

5、用轉置運算子 (') 將行向量轉換為列向量。

6、可以通過在一條命令中建立行向量並將其全部轉置來建立列向量。注意此處使用圓括號來指定運算的順序。

x=(1:2:5)'x=135

7、注意,如果您使用linspace:建立向量,則不需要使用方括號 ()。

matlab陣列的建立

原文 1 直接輸入 行向量 a 1,2,3,4,5 列向量 a 1 2 3 4 5 2 用 生成向量 a j k 生成的行向量是a j,j 1,k a j d k 生成行向量a j,j d,j m d m fix k j d 3 函式linspace 用來生成資料按等差形式排列的行向量 x lins...

Matlab陣列建立

只用c語言,不用matlab這種魔咒還是要打破的。matlab是科學計算的常用工具,既然以前沒用過,現在開始學吧.1 向量的建立 1 直接輸入 行向量 a 1,2,3,4,5 列向量 a 1 2 3 4 5 2 用 生成向量 a j k 生成的行向量是a j,j 1,k a j d k 生成行向量a...

Matlab學習筆記(二)

四灰色 五遺傳演算法 六神經網路 先等等再學這個。主程式 用遺傳演算法求解y 200 exp 0.05 x sin x 再 2 2 上的最大值 clc clear all close all global bitlength global st global ed bounds 2 2 一維變數的取...